Mauricio Pochettino has left Chelsea by mutual agreement after only one season in charge.
The Argentine guided the London club to sixth in the Premier League season just gone.
Fermanagh's Kieran McKenna, currently the boss of Ipswich Town, could be a contender for the vacant role at Stamford Bridge.
